sasl-login (Re: proposal for new SASL client APIs)

岡田 健一 / Kenichi OKADA okada @ opaopa.org
2000年 11月 8日 (水) 13:04:47 JST


おかだです。

In the message "Re: sasl-login (Re: proposal for new SASL client APIs)"
               <87d7g77r7u.fsf @ gg.bug.org>
Daiki Ueno <suimin @ bug.org> wrote:

> >>>>> In [emacs-mime-ja : No.00648] 
> >>>>>	okada @ opaopa.org (岡田 健一 / Kenichi OKADA) wrote:

> > sasl-login-response-{1|2}で、(sasl-step-data step)をチェックしていますが、
> > これは必要ですか?
> > imap-2000では、"User Name\0", "Password\0" というのを返すようです.

> ;; ありゃ、IMAP 2000 release されていたのですね。^_^;;

最近のものでは、STARTTLSやimapsとかが使えるようになりました.

;; 全経路(SMTP,POP,IMAP,NNTP)を暗号化できて幸せです…
;; あとは、INN+cyrus-saslなコードを書けば完成かな…

> > とりあえず、
> > (string-match "^user ?name." (sasl-step-data step)
> > (string-match "^password." (sasl-step-data step))
> > にしておきました.

> この部分は Cyrus SASL の login plugin の挙動を真似たのですが、
> LOGIN mechanism に関しては仕様がないので、どちらでも良いと思います。

> ;; 純正品(?) ということから言うと、IMAP 2000 を信じるのが、
> ;; 恐らく正しいのでしょう。

[emacs-mime-ja: 00090]で書きましたが、確か、IMAP 2000よりも、
Microsoft Exchange Server
Netscape Messenger
が初めに実装したんだと思います.

sasl.elの実装の際に参考にしたWebがあったのですが、
今はなくなっているようです.

まあ、問題が発生したら修正するというとこで…

-- 
岡田 健一  URLs: mailto:okada @ opaopa.org
	   	 http://www.opaopa.org




More information about the Emacs-mime-ja mailing list